The Accounting study plan at King Faisal University is an accredited bachelor programme spanning about 4 years (8 academic levels), requiring 135 credit hours across 33 courses of required and elective study. The table below lists the courses and their credit hours for each level.

Level 1 8 credits

Code Course Credits
مال 1100 Principles of Finance 1 3
نجل 2103 English Language Skills 1 2
احص 1110 Principles of Statistics 3

Level 2 12 credits

Code Course Credits
نجل 2104 Business English 1 3
دار 1101 Business Law 3
احص 1113 Analytical Statistics 3
قصد 1102 Principles of Microeconomics 3

Level 3 12 credits

Code Course Credits
قصد 1201 Principles of Macroeconomics 3
حسب 1201 Principles of Financial Accounting 1 3
دار 1201 Principles of Management 3
تسق 1201 Principles of Marketing 3

Level 4 14 credits

Code Course Credits
امن 1201 Principles of Insurance and Risk Management 3
حسب 1202 Principles of Cost and Managerial Accounting 3
دار 1205 Principles of Innovation and Entrepreneurship 2
مال 1200 Principles of Finance 2 3
حسب 1203 Principles of Financial Accounting 2 3

Level 5 16 credits

Code Course Credits
حسب 1306 Internal Auditing 3
حسب 1301 Intermediate Accounting 1 4
حسب 1303 Zakat Accounting 2
حسب 1302 Managerial Accounting 3
حسب 1314 Cost Accounting 4

Level 6 17 credits

Code Course Credits
حسب 1309 Auditing 1 3
حسب 1304 Tax Accounting 4
حسب 1310 Intermediate Accounting 2 4
حسب 1311 Selected Accounting Topics in English 3
حسب 1315 Accounting Information Systems and Artificial Intelligence 3

Level 7 18 credits

Code Course Credits
حسب 1401 Advanced Accounting 4
حسب 1402 Auditing 2 3
حسب 1403 Accounting in Specialized Entities 4
حسب 1405 Financial Statement Analysis 4
حسب 1406 Accounting in Public and Non-Profit Entities 3

Level 8 9 credits

Code Course Credits
حسب 1491 Accounting Research 3
حسب 1499 Cooperative Training 6
